IMPORTANT NOTICE TO TOURISTS ANDOTHERS. rriELEGRAPH LINE OF ROYAL A MAIL COACH KS between Cambridge and the Hot Lake District. TiML-TAULK : Leaves Cambridge, carrying H.M. uiaila, on Tuesday, Thursday, ami Saturday at 7 a.m. Leaves Ohinemutu on Monday, Wednesday, and Friday at 7 a.m., arming in Cambridge about ."> p.m. Coaches running from Ohinemutu to Wairoa and Tikitere daily. Farks : £ s. d. Cambridge to Ohinemutu, single 1 13 0 Cambridge to Ohiuemutu, icturn 3 0 0 Ohinemutu to Waiioa, single 10 0 » „ return 15 0 „ „ Tikitere, return 10 0 Parties can make arrangements for private coaches to visit any part of the Hot Lake Distiict, and through to Napier. Saddle horses and buggies always on hire. Letters and telegrams piomptly attended to. W.K. CARTER, Coach Proprietor. Cambridge, 26th January, ISiw. OPENING OF MORRINSVILLE RAILWAY.
